Chatham, also known as Chatham Lighthouse Beach, lies just under the watchful eye of the Chatham Lighthouse, which actively guides sea traffic in these parts. Although the lighthouse is generally closed to visitors, it can be visited once a year during the summer and is free of charge.

Some areas are closed on the southern edge of the beach because the waters there are pretty dynamic and wild. Some parts are open to the public and you can swim or take a boat ride there. Chatham also offers some of the best seafood around.
